Radius 200 Review
Michael from Brentwood, CA on 4/11/2016
I use this center speaker in combination with the monitor audio bookshelf Silver 2 speakers. The timbre matching is very good. I also like the fact that compared to the monitor audio Silver Center, the sound if almost identical for quite a bit less $$. I am not so much concerned about the lower end since the receiver takes care of routing that to the subwoofer.
Pros: size, price
Cons: this is a ported speaker so if you use it in an enclosure, such as a TV console, you should plug the port.

Monitor Audio Radius 200
Redwood from palm harbor, FL on 2/29/2016
Speaker a perfect fit for where I wanted to place it. It sounds strong for its size. Unfortunately it does echo quite a bit on dialog. Hard to adjust it. I would have to adjust from channel to channel and sometimes from a show to commercials. Meaning the commercials sound better than the show. It does echo quite a bit when watching movies. It sounds perfect when listening to music.
Pros: Correct size for what I wanted and sounds strong. Music sounds very good.
Cons: Way too much echoing on dialog. High volume distorts too much and low volume makes dialog hard to understand.

MA Radius 200
J.K. from Indiana on 5/26/2015
I recently purchased the Monitor Audio Silver 8 speakers and i needed the center channel to go with it but i was tired of paying big money for center speakers so i decided to try the MA Radius 200 to go with the Silver 8's. When it arrived i was worried that it was too small but it looked really cool. After playing several movies i am very pleased with sound quality and detail. I have had center speakers that cost twice this much but did not sound as good. Even though i did not buy the matching center channel to go with the Silver 8 i really have not noticed an issue with the sound difference between the Silver and the Radius 200, but i did stick with Monitor Audio. I loved the fact that it is small but it definitely delivers on sound. Great speaker with a fantastic look.
Pros: Great sound and detail. Awesome looking.
Cons: none
